    Hair Removal Safety: An All-Inclusive Guide to Precautions and Reducing Side Effects

    GraceBy GraceDecember 27, 2023085 Mins Read
    Share Facebook Twitter Pinterest LinkedIn Tumblr Email
    Share
    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est Email

    Many people are using hair removal machines as a convenient solution when it comes to achieving hair skin. Safety must always come first, whether you’re using one at home or at a salon receiving treatments.

    This article focuses on ways to reduce any potential side effects and safety precautions to take when using hair removal machines.

    Getting to Know Your Hair and Skin Type

    Understanding your skin and hair type is crucial before getting into the hair removal world. For different skin tones and hair colors, different devices and techniques are made.

    Consult the user manual to make sure you have a more productive experience. To find out which machine is best for your skin type, consult a professional..

    Conducting Patch Tests

    It is always advisable to perform a patch test before using any type of hair removal machine. This entails testing the device on a discrete area of your body to see if there are any adverse reactions.

    You can find out about any sensitivities in advance by doing this step. Lower the possibility of adverse effects that spread.

    Prioritize Cleanliness and Prepare Your Skin

    Keeping things clean is essential for hair removal. Make sure to thoroughly cleanse your skin to get rid of any debris, oil, or makeup that might compromise the machine’s performance. To get results and avoid ingrown hairs, exfoliate your skin the day before using the device.

    Protect Your Eyes

    Strong light flashes from hair removal devices that use lasers or intense pulsed light (IPL) have the potential to cause eye damage. To protect your eyes from harm during the treatment session, always wear the recommended or supplied eye protection.

    Control the Temperature

    Temperature control is crucial when using heat-based technologies, such as lasers. To avoid burns or discomfort, avoid using the machine on skin and use caution when exposing yourself. Certain gadgets have cooling systems built in for user security and comfort.

    Follow the Manufacturer’s Instructions

    Every skin hair removal machine includes instructions provided by the manufacturer. It is crucial to read and carefully follow these instructions. Pay attention to recommended settings, treatment durations as any warnings or contraindications. Deviating from these guidelines can increase the risk of experiencing side effects.

    Minimize Sun Exposure

    Exposing your skin to sunlight can heighten the risk of experiencing side effects when using hair removal machines.

    It is recommended to avoid exposure to sunlight or using tanning beds for a minimum of two weeks before and after the treatment. Sunburned or tanned skin tends to be more vulnerable to damage during the hair removal process.

    Minimizing Potential Side Effects

    Although hair removal machines are generally safe when used correctly there are side effects that users should be mindful of. Here are some occurring side effects and tips on how to minimize them:

    • Redness and Irritation

    1. After the treatment apply a moisturizer without fragrance to soothe the skin.
    2. To reduce redness and irritation you can use aloe vera gel or apply a compress.
    • Changes in Pigmentation

    1.  Prioritize avoiding sun exposure both before and after the treatment.
    2. In case hyperpigmentation occurs it is advised to consult with a dermatologist for treatments.
    • Blisters and Burns

    1. Ensure that the machine’s intensity level is appropriate for your skin type.
    2. If blisters or burns occur, refrain from undergoing treatments until your skin has completely healed.
    • Ingrown Hairs

    1. exfoliate your skin to prevent ingrown hairs.
    2. Consider using, over the counter exfoliating products. Seek professional treatments if ingrown hairs persist.
    • Allergic Reactions

    1. It’s recommended to conduct patch tests on products or machines in order to identify potential allergens beforehand.
    2. If you have a reaction, stop using the product and consult a professional.

    Post Treatment Aftercare

    After using a hair removal device, it’s important to take care to help your skin recover and minimize any side effects;

    • Avoid Hot Showers and Saunas

     Using hot water can irritate your skin. It’s best to opt for showers and avoid saunas for at least 24 hours.

    • Gentle Cleansing

     Use a cleanser without fragrance to prevent irritation.

    • Moisturize

     Keep your skin hydrated by applying a moisturizer that promotes healing.

    • Protect from Sun Exposure

     Apply sunscreen with spectrum protection and a high SPF to shield the treated area from UV rays.

    When to Seek Professional Advice

    If you experience persistent or severe side effects it’s crucial to seek guidance from dermatologists or skincare professionals.

    They can provide advice, recommend treatments and address any concerns regarding the use of hair removal devices.
